About
American Black Belt Academy offers Kids Martial Arts classes, including Tiny Tigers, Kids American Karate, Kids Brazilian Jiu Jitsu, and Kids Boxing/Kickboxing. The program also includes American Kenpo Karate, Brazilian Jiu Jitsu, Boxing/Kickboxing, Mixed Martial Arts, Adult Martial Arts, Personal Training, Self Defense training, and a Fitness program. Additional options include an After School Program, Day Camps, Summer Camp, Birthday Parties, and the Lights Out Boxing fitness program.

American Black Belt Academy was founded in 1994 by Tom and Lorraine LoVarco and is now celebrating 31 years serving the Massapequa community. The school describes itself as a school of self defense and as one of the largest training facilities on Long Island, offering martial arts training for adults and kids. Programs are available for children as young as 3 1/2 years old, and classes are arranged by ability and age with special attention to every child.
Head instructor Tom LoVarco is a 9th Degree Black Belt and the Vice President of the Worldwide Kenpo Karate Association. The mission of American Black Belt Academy is to specialize in self defense strategies through American Kenpo Karate, Brazilian Jiu Jitsu, and Kickboxing, and to offer self defense and fitness with an award-winning children's program dedicated to the total development of students, including developing strong bodies, a healthy outlook on life, respect for adults, and a successful attitude.
In 2006, United Professionals and Black Belt Schools of America ranked American Black Belt Academy as one of the top 50 schools in the country. Each year since then, the Worldwide Kenpo Karate Association has ranked American Black Belt Academy the number one American Kenpo Karate school in the United States.
